Whatever the case, you’ll never find a 100 percent natural hair dye that doesn’t contain any chemicals at all—because for hair color to work, a chemical reaction must occur. It’s worth noting that there is one exception here—pure henna, although that’s another story, as it can create problems of its own. There are no hair dyes that are 100% harmless, as even natural and organic hair dyes carry some potential for allergic reactions or sensitivities in certain individuals. However, natural and organic hair dyes made solely from plant-based ingredients like henna, cassia, indigo, beetroot, and botanical oils/extracts are considered the gentlest and closest to being harmless.
